What Are Hazard Classes?

Simply put, hazard classes categorize items based on their potential for explosion and fire risks. Think of these classes as the first line of defense in recognizing the dangers inherent in different materials. In a military setting, where the stakes are especially high, knowing these categories can be critical. Why? Because they help in ensuring that personnel handle, store, and transport materials in a way that minimizes risk.

So, What Criteria Are Used?

At the core of hazard classification is the evaluation of explosion and fire risks. This assessment focuses on:

  • Potential for Explosion: Does the item have explosive properties? If so, how likely is it to detonate? Understanding these factors is crucial for operational safety.

  • Fire Risks: Items are also evaluated based on how easily they might catch fire or produce flames. This can depend on their physical properties, chemical makeup, and environmental conditions.

By sorting items this way, military personnel can create tailored protocols for managing these materials—think specific instructions for transporting explosives versus handling flammable substances. Isn't it fascinating how much safety measures hinge on a well-thought-out classification system?

Practical Implications and Safety Measures

Understanding hazard classes isn't merely an academic exercise; it has real-world implications. It instructs protocols for handling materials—action steps that can prevent accidents before they happen. Picture this: if a flammable substance were packaged alongside an explosive without proper categorization, the results could be disastrous. This isn’t just a matter of protocol; it’s a matter of life.

So, operational crews are trained not just to recognize the hazard classes but also to internalize and apply strict handling guidelines. These measures might include:

  • Specific Storage Instructions: Only storing certain items together if their classifications allow for it.

  • Transportation Protocols: Ensuring that high-risk materials are secured in ways that prevent movement and potential accidents.

  • Emergency Response Plans: Preparing for worst-case scenarios based on the classification of stored materials.
